The SKIRT project
advanced radiative transfer for astrophysics
User Guide

This guide describes how to use the SKIRT code and the Python Toolkit for SKIRT (PTS). The table below lists the various topics. You can review them in the presented order or simply skip to topics of interest. We highly recommend that you work through the hand-on tutorials (marked with a keyboard icon). See the Icon legend at the end of the page, below the table.

Also see: Key features of the SKIRT code; Key features of the Python Toolkit for SKIRT (PTS); Installation Guide; Recent changes

Level Type Topic
Components of the SKIRT project
Monochromatic simulation of a dusty disk galaxy
Panchromatic simulation of a dust torus
SKIRT Q&A and command line options
Using PTS on the command line
MakeUp, the graphical interface for SKIRT parameter files
The SKIRT parameter file format (ski file)
Upgrading SKIRT parameter files
The SKIRT units system & supported units
Stochastic heating in an SPH-simulated galaxy
Visualizing SKIRT results with PTS
X-ray reprocessing in a clumpy AGN torus
Scattering by dust in a Kelvin-Helmholtz instability
Building a proper spatial grid for a spiral galaxy
Spatial grids and meshes overview
Wavelength treatment during a simulation
Wavelength grids overview
Configuring wavelength grids
Inspecting the built-in broadband filters
Material mixes (dust, electrons, gas)
Importing snapshots
Probes and forms
Volumetric data and 3D plots
Nonzero redshift & CMB dust heating
Self-consistent iterative calculations
Parallel threads and/or multiple processes
Using PTS in interactive Python notebooks
Using PTS in Python programs
Reliability statistics for simulated fluxes
Dust scattering polarization signatures of spiral galaxies
Configuring for polarized radiation
Configuring the photon packet life cycle
Configuring for Lyman-alpha resonant line transfer
Configuring custom dust mixes
Normalizing multiple dust components

Icon legend

Icon Description
Basic user level
Regular user level
Expert user level
Hands-on tutorial
Overview and background
Configuration guidance